1. Accessibility and Efficiency:
Among the primary known reasons for the extensive appeal of internet poker is its accessibility. As opposed to br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ises, online poker platforms provide players the freedom to relax and play any time, everywhere. With a well balanced net connection, poker enthusiasts will enjoy a common online game from the comfort of their particular houses, eliminating the necessity for travel. Furthermore, internet poker websites offer many options, including different variations of poker, tournaments, and different risk levels, providing to players of most skill levels.
2. Worldwide Athlete Base:
Internet poker transcends geographical boundaries, allowing players from all sides of world to vie against each other. This interconnectedness fosters a varied and difficult environment, enabling players to evaluate their skills against opponents with varying techniques and playing designs. 3. Lower Prices and Smaller Stakes:
Compared to traditional gambling enterprises, playing poker on the web can notably keep your charges down. On line systems have actually lower expense costs, allowing them to offer lower stakes and decreased entry costs for tournaments. This is why internet poker accessible to a wider audience, including novices and informal people, which may find the large stakes of real time casinos intimidating. The capability to fool around with smaller stakes in addition provides a sense of monetary protection, enabling people to handle their money more effectively.
4. Improved Game Access and Variety:
Online poker platforms provide a huge selection of online game options and variants. Whether it's texas hold em, Omaha, or Seven-Card Stud, people will find their favored online game easily and instantly. Furthermore, online platforms frequently introduce new poker variations, spicing up the game play and maintaining the feeling fresh for people. The availability of a variety of tables and tournaments ensures that players always find suitable choices while not having to await a seat at a table.
5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While internet poker brings numerous benefits, it isn't without its challenges. Among significant disadvantages is the possibility of deceptive activities, including collusion and chip dumping, where people cheat to achieve an unfair advantage. But reputable internet poker platforms use robust security steps and arbitrary quantity generators to thwart these types of behavior. In addition, some players could find the lack of real cues and communications being section of live poker games a disadvantage, as they can be harder to read through opponents and use psychological strategies on line.
